For bug #185670, make sure package.use.{mask,force} are properly displayed.
authorZac Medico <zmedico@gentoo.org>
Tue, 17 Jul 2007 18:19:11 +0000 (18:19 -0000)
committerZac Medico <zmedico@gentoo.org>
Tue, 17 Jul 2007 18:19:11 +0000 (18:19 -0000)
svn path=/main/trunk/; revision=7296

pym/emerge/__init__.py

index 0d506de05059bbddb6c7fbb15255c7b5d8118412..2246d9cf4047c8b53cdcd4e03f7559367dcd707b 100644 (file)
@@ -2819,6 +2819,7 @@ class depgraph(object):
                                                mydbapi.aux_get(pkg_key, ["IUSE"])[0].split()))
 
                                        forced_flags = set()
+                                       pkgsettings.setcpv(pkg_key) # for package.use.{mask,force}
                                        forced_flags.update(pkgsettings.useforce)
                                        forced_flags.update(pkgsettings.usemask)